Adding RSS feeds to your squidoo lenses is a good way to keep the lens content fresh.This is a big help when managing several lenses and having to update the content almost everyday. So how to add rss feeds to your Squidoo lens ?
It's a simple process. When creating the lens , add an RSS module to it. Rearrange it's layout on the lens by using the drag and drop buttons. Give your RSS module a title.It could be anything relevant to the feeds you are generating , for example if your lens is on staying fit , you can title the rss module as "Health News from around the world". Give the module a subtitle if you want , this is optional .You can go back and edit it anytime. If you want the feeds from your blog or another site you are familiar with , then you may want to use the description box as well.
Now it's time to add the Rss feeds url to the lens. For this , visit the site you want to collect the rss feeds from and locate the RSS feed icon. When you click on the icon it will take you to the RSS feed page from where you can copy the correct rss feed url. Type or paste this url in the url box of the RSS module.
You can choose the number of headlines you want to show on your lens. I usually allow 3 feeds and an excerpt of 100 characters. Choose how frequently you want the module to be updated and whether you want them to use html. Once you are done , click save. Now the module should automatically collect RSS feeds from the feed url.
You can now make any changes to the title and subtitle by clicking on edit. Once you have prepared the lens and added the rss feed, click on the Publish button. The rss module will always keep adding fresh content to your lens without you having to worry about it.
